Thomas Robinson is going to add to some team’s frontcourt and the latest mock from DraftExpress has the New Orleans Hornets selecting Robinson at No. 4 overall in the 2012 NBA Draft. Robinson is considered one of the best bigs in the entire draft, and Anthony Davis is likely the only frontcourt player who will be chosen ahead of him.
The Kansas forward was a finalist for the National Player of the Year award in college basketball last season after averaging 18 points and 12 rebounds per game for the Jayhawks. Robinson took the team to the title game before losing to Kentucky in the 2012 NCAA Tournament. It was an unexpected run for a KU team that most believed would even concede their run of Big 12 supremacy.
The draft lottery is tonight and will go a big way toward determining where Robinson could get taken.
